(Case C-252/10 P) (<span class="super">1</span>)
(Appeal - Public procurement - European Maritime Safety Agency (EMSA) - Call for tenders relating to the ‘SafeSeaNet’ application - Decision rejecting a tenderer’s bid - Contract award criteria - Sub-criteria - Obligation to state reasons)
2011/C 269/24
Language of the case: English
Appellant: Evropaïki Dynamiki — Proigmena Systimata Tilepikoinonion Pliroforikis kai Tilematikis AE (represented by: N. Korogiannakis, dikigoros)
Other party to the proceedings: European Maritime Safety Agency (EMSA) (represented by: J. Menze, acting as Agent, and by J. Stuyck and A.-M. Vandromme, advocaaten)
Appeal brought against the judgment of the General Court (Third Chamber) of 2 March 2010 in Case T-70/05 (Evropaïki Dynamiki v EMSA) in so far it dismissed the appellant’s application for the annulment of the decision of the European Maritime Safety Agency (‘EMSA’) of 6 January 2005 rejecting the tender submitted by the appellant in a tendering procedure relating to the validation of the SafeSeaNet application and its further development
The Court:
1.Dismisses the appeal;
2.Orders Evropaïki Dynamiki — Proigmena Systimata Tilepikoinonion Pliroforikis kai Tilematikis AE to pay the costs.
